Output 61c34a2f31e18946f4a141f75b5744dde4f1013b1ba796e18e68877610ff4a53:12

value
232726369
script pubkey
OP_0 OP_PUSHBYTES_20 17700e34f43c8ddbc7b25e99bf49cfef246b4d03
address
bc1qzacqud858jxah3ajt6vm7jw0aujxkngrrzrj0q
transaction
61c34a2f31e18946f4a141f75b5744dde4f1013b1ba796e18e68877610ff4a53
spent
true